They are in fact present. I have drilled down the issue and what I have found is that the error occurs not in save() but as soon as I instantiate the base class.
The error is that inside the Torque code the code used to dynamically load the class is Class.forName() which is using the System Class Loader by defaultt to load the class. If I do a simple test to try and load the class with the System Class Loader it definitely is not found. HOWEVER, if I get the class laoder from the test application and try to dynamically load the class all is well. I am going to try and hack the Torque code myself to use a different class loader, to see if that helps, but I am concerned that it may in fact be an Orion problem. Orion is the container I am using presently. -A -----Original Message----- From: Bill Schneider [mailto:[EMAIL PROTECTED]] Sent: Tuesday, April 30, 2002 8:41 AM To: Turbine Torque Users List; [EMAIL PROTECTED] Subject: Re: Initial startup problems -- ClassNotFoundException I'd first double-check and make sure that the MapBuilder classes got built and are present; in a webapp environment, these classes should be under WEB-INF/classes/com/cram/db/om/map -- Bill ----- Original Message ----- From: "Andrew" <[EMAIL PROTECTED]> To: <[EMAIL PROTECTED]> Sent: Monday, April 29, 2002 5:20 PM Subject: Initial startup problems -- ClassNotFoundException > Hi all, > > Trying to get decoupled Torque up and running for the first time. So far I > have it generating my java and sql just great. However, when I go to execute > a save() I get all kinds of troubles trying to find the MapBuilder classes. > Everything is in my classpath just fine. Any suggestions? > > 2002-04-29 16:55:47,044 ERROR util.BasePeer (BasePeer.java:2162) - > BasePeer.MapB > uilder failed trying to instantiate: com.cram.db.om.map.ChannelDOMapBuilder > java.lang.ClassNotFoundException: com.cram.db.om.map.ChannelDOMapBuilder > at com.evermind._dz.findClass(Unknown Source) > at java.lang.ClassLoader.loadClass(ClassLoader.java:306) > at java.lang.ClassLoader.loadClass(ClassLoader.java:262) > at java.lang.ClassLoader.loadClassInternal(ClassLoader.java:322) > at java.lang.Class.forName0(Native Method) > at java.lang.Class.forName(Class.java:130) > at org.apache.torque.util.BasePeer.getMapBuilder(BasePeer.java:2117) > at > com.project.db.om.BaseChannelDOPeer.getMapBuilder(BaseChannelDOPeer.java > :40) > at > com.project.db.om.BaseChannelDOPeer.<clinit>(BaseChannelDOPeer.java:58) > at com.project.db.om.BaseChannelDO.<clinit>(BaseChannelDO.java:26) > at > com.project.server.servlets.CramServlet.setupTorque(CramServlet.java:98) > > at > com.project.server.servlets.StartServlet.init(StartServlet.java:48) > at com.evermind._ah._axe(Unknown Source) > at com.evermind._ah._fpd(Unknown Source) > at com.evermind._ah._bae(Unknown Source) > at com.evermind._ah._bie(Unknown Source) > at com.evermind._ah.<init>(Unknown Source) > at com.evermind._ck._czc(Unknown Source) > at com.evermind._ae._czc(Unknown Source) > at com.evermind._ab._crc(Unknown Source) > at com.evermind._ab._at(Unknown Source) > at com.evermind._ae._an(Unknown Source) > at com.evermind._ae._at(Unknown Source) > at com.evermind.server.ApplicationServer._wh(Unknown Source) > at com.evermind.server.ApplicationServer._at(Unknown Source) > at com.evermind._in.run(Unknown Source) > at java.lang.Thread.run(Thread.java:536) > at com.evermind._if.run(Unknown Source) > 2002-04-29 16:55:47,044 ERROR util.BasePeer (BasePeer.java:2162) - > BasePeer.MapB > uilder failed trying to instantiate: > com.project.db.om.map.ChannelDOMapBuilder > java.lang.ClassNotFoundException: com.project.db.om.map.ChannelDOMapBuilder > at com.evermind._dz.findClass(Unknown Source) > at java.lang.ClassLoader.loadClass(ClassLoader.java:306) > at java.lang.ClassLoader.loadClass(ClassLoader.java:262) > at java.lang.ClassLoader.loadClassInternal(ClassLoader.java:322) > at java.lang.Class.forName0(Native Method) > at java.lang.Class.forName(Class.java:130) > at org.apache.torque.util.BasePeer.getMapBuilder(BasePeer.java:2117) > at > com.project.db.om.BaseChannelDOPeer.getMapBuilder(BaseChannelDOPeer.java > :40) > at com.project.db.om.BaseChannelDO.save(BaseChannelDO.java:360) > at > com.project.server.servlets.StartServlet.setupTorque(StartServlet.java:101 > ) > at > com.project.server.servlets.StartServlet.init(StartServlet.java:48) > at com.evermind._ah._axe(Unknown Source) > at com.evermind._ah._fpd(Unknown Source) > at com.evermind._ah._bae(Unknown Source) > at com.evermind._ah._bie(Unknown Source) > at com.evermind._ah.<init>(Unknown Source) > at com.evermind._ck._czc(Unknown Source) > at com.evermind._ae._czc(Unknown Source) > at com.evermind._ab._crc(Unknown Source) > at com.evermind._ab._at(Unknown Source) > at com.evermind._ae._an(Unknown Source) > at com.evermind._ae._at(Unknown Source) > at com.evermind.server.ApplicationServer._wh(Unknown Source) > at com.evermind.server.ApplicationServer._at(Unknown Source) > at com.evermind._in.run(Unknown Source) > at java.lang.Thread.run(Thread.java:536) > at com.evermind._if.run(Unknown Source) > 2002-04-29 16:55:47,054 ERROR servlets.StartServlet (Log4JLogger.java:34) - > Error > starting Torque > 2002-04-29 16:55:47,144 ERROR servlets.StartServlet (Log4JLogger.java:34) - > java. > lang.NullPointerException > com.project.db.om.BaseChannelDO.save(BaseChannelDO.java:361) > > > -- > To unsubscribe, e-mail: <mailto:[EMAIL PROTECTED]> > For additional commands, e-mail: <mailto:[EMAIL PROTECTED]> > -- To unsubscribe, e-mail: <mailto:[EMAIL PROTECTED]> For additional commands, e-mail: <mailto:[EMAIL PROTECTED]>
